Solution Overview
Problem
Conventional expansion anchors with circular bolt cross-sections face a dilemma where increasing sleeve thickness for better anchoring reduces the bolt's breaking load, limiting load capacity without weakening the bolt.
Innovation Solution
Incorporating a web with local increased wall thickness and a corresponding groove in the bolt's neck area, allowing the web to rest on an inclined surface in the expansion area, enabling radial outward push and maximizing sleeve expansion without significantly weakening the bolt.

The invention relates to an expansion anchor (1) with a bolt (10) having a neck region (11) and an expansion region (12) adjoining the neck region, in which the bolt tapers towards the neck region, wherein the bolt has a groove (15) in the neck region extending along the length of the bolt, and with an expansion sleeve (20) which at least partially surrounds the bolt and which has a web (25) on its inner side, wherein the web engages at least partially in the groove in the neck region, and wherein the wall thickness of the expansion sleeve is locally increased by the web, wherein the expansion sleeve is displaceable from the neck region into the expansion region along the bolt by radial expansion. According to the invention, when the expansion sleeve is displaced from the neck region into the expansion region, the web enters the expansion region at least partially and is forced radially outwards by the expansion region.
